About the Role

This setting supports young people who have struggled in mainstream education due to:

  • Anxiety and depression
  • Emotionally Based School Avoidance (EBSA)
  • Trauma and negative school experiences
  • Social, Emotional and Mental Health (SEMH) needs

Your role will focus on rebuilding confidence, trust, and emotional safety, enabling students to gradually return to learning in a structured and supportive environment.

You'll work in a small, nurturing setting with a strong focus on:

  • Emotional regulation
  • Relationship building
  • Personalised learning approaches

Why This Role is Ideal for Your Clinical Aspirations

This position is more than just a support role—it is a foundational training ground for your future career as a Clinical Psychologist. You will not be observing from the sidelines; you will be an active participant in the therapeutic and educational process, applying psychological principles in real-time.

Here is how this role directly bridges to your clinical goals:

  • Translate Theory into Practice: You will move beyond textbooks and apply core psychological concepts—such as attachment theory, trauma-informed care, and cognitive-behavioural models—to understand and support complex presentations of anxiety and school avoidance.
  • Develop Clinical Assessment Skills: You will learn to identify how underlying emotional and psychological distress manifests as behaviour. This experience is crucial for developing the observational and formulation skills needed for clinical training.
  • Build a Therapeutic Alliance: You will practice building trust and rapport with highly vulnerable young people who have experienced significant relational trauma. This mirrors the foundational skill of establishing a therapeutic alliance in clinical settings.
  • Understand Multi-Agency Working: You will collaborate with therapists, educational psychologists, and social workers, gaining first‑hand insight into how clinical professionals operate within a multi‑disciplinary team and how psychological interventions are implemented in real‑world environments.
